V Spot Café is hosting an Eat, Pay, Love dinner as part of Anti-Poverty Week in Canberra!
The profits from the evening will be donated to YWCA Canberra to support our Lanyon Food Hub.
An Eat, Pay, Love dinner means you can enjoy a restaurant meal with no set prices. Guests are asked to pay what they feel the meal is worth, keeping mind that they are also making a contribution to food relief in Canberra via our Food Hub!
